Starting a tech company in India can be an exciting and rewarding journey. The country’s growing digital market offers immense opportunities for innovation. If you are wondering how to start a tech company in India, this guide will walk you through the process step-by-step. From planning to launching, everything is simplified for easy understanding.
Why Start a Tech Company in India?
India is one of the fastest-growing tech hubs in the world. With a large talent pool, affordable resources, and a supportive startup ecosystem, it’s an ideal place to build a tech business. The government also promotes startups through initiatives like Startup India. Additionally, the demand for digital solutions is increasing, making it a perfect time to start. Look at Chennai Super Kings vs Mumbai Indians Match Scorecard
Steps to Start a Tech Company in India
1. Have a Clear Idea
The first step is to have a clear business idea. Your idea should solve a problem or fulfill a need in the market. Do some research to understand your audience. For example, if you want to build a mobile app, identify who will use it and why they need it.
2. Write a Business Plan
A business plan is essential. It helps you stay focused and gives investors confidence in your idea. Include the following in your plan:
- Executive Summary: Brief about your business idea.
- Market Analysis: Research about competitors and target audience.
- Financial Plan: Budget and revenue forecasts.
- Marketing Strategy: How you will promote your company.
3. Choose the Right Business Structure
You need to register your company legally. Decide on the type of business structure:
- Sole Proprietorship: For small-scale businesses.
- Partnership: For shared ownership.
- Private Limited Company: For startups aiming for funding.
Each structure has its benefits. A private limited company is the most popular for tech startups because it attracts investors easily.
4. Register Your Business
After selecting the structure, register your company with the Ministry of Corporate Affairs (MCA). You will need documents like:
- PAN card
- Address proof
- Digital Signature Certificate (DSC)
- Director Identification Number (DIN)
5. Build Your Team
A tech company requires skilled professionals. Hire people who align with your vision. Focus on building a team with expertise in development, marketing, and management. If you can’t afford full-time employees, hire freelancers or collaborate with partners initially.
6. Create a Minimum Viable Product (MVP)
Before launching a full-fledged product, create an MVP. It’s a basic version of your product to test its viability. Use feedback from early users to improve your product.
7. Secure Funding
Starting a tech company in India requires money. Explore funding options like:
- Bootstrapping: Use your own savings.
- Angel Investors: Individuals who invest in startups.
- Venture Capitalists: Firms investing in high-potential startups.
- Startup India: Government schemes for funding.
Prepare a strong pitch to attract investors. Highlight your business potential and revenue model.
8. Focus on Marketing
Marketing is essential for success. Use digital platforms like:
- Social Media: Promote on Instagram, LinkedIn, and Facebook.
- Content Marketing: Write blogs and make videos.
- SEO: Optimize your website to rank higher on Google.
Having an online presence builds trust and attracts customers.
9. Stay Compliant
Adhere to legal and tax requirements in India. Register for GST, maintain financial records, and file annual returns. Non-compliance can lead to penalties, so take this seriously.
10. Scale Your Business
Once your company is stable, focus on scaling. Introduce new products, expand to different markets, and upgrade your technology. A tech company should always innovate to stay ahead of competitors.
Challenges of Starting a Tech Company in India
Starting a tech company in India is not without challenges. Some common issues include:
- Funding: Convincing investors can be tough.
- Competition: The market is crowded with startups.
- Hiring: Finding the right talent takes time.
- Regulations: Navigating legal formalities can be confusing.
However, with persistence and a solid plan, these challenges can be overcome.
FAQs
Q1. What are the main benefits of starting a tech company in India?
India offers affordable resources, a talented workforce, and a growing digital market. Government initiatives like Startup India also provide funding and support.
Q2. How much money is needed to start a tech company?
The cost depends on your business idea. It can range from ₹5 lakhs to ₹50 lakhs or more. Start small and scale up gradually.
Q3. Do I need a co-founder for my tech company?
It’s not mandatory, but having a co-founder can help. They can share responsibilities and bring additional skills to the table.
Q4. How do I attract investors?
Create a strong business plan and MVP. Highlight your market potential and explain how your product solves a problem. Build a network to connect with investors.
Q5. Can I start a tech company as a student?
Yes, many students start tech companies while studying. Focus on developing your idea and building a team. Seek mentorship and funding from startup incubators.
Starting a tech company in India is challenging but achievable. If you follow these steps and stay committed, your dream of owning a tech company can become a reality. Take one step at a time and keep learning. If you need guest post service click here.